Rector of UNS Send Out Green Walk Participants for UNS 44th Anniversary

UNS – To commemorate UNS 44th Anniversary, Universitas Sebelas Maret (UNS) Surakarta held a Green Walk, Friday morning (6/3/2020). All academic members of UNS from the rectory, faculties, postgraduate, units, institutes, vocational school, cooperative, and UNS Hospital attended the event.

From Friday morning, the participants gathered in the UNS stadium. Before departing, the participants join the gymnastic activity.

In line with UNS characters, the participants followed ‘Goyang Semar’ gymnastic move led by the Dean of the Faculty of Sport (FKOR), Dr. Sapta Kunta Purnama, M. Pd., accompanied by an instructor and Sports Coaching Education students (Penkepor) FKOR. Dr. Sapta Kunta looked enthusiastic in leading the gymnastics.

On the occasion, the FKOR UNS students also attended to enliven the Goyang Semar gymnast. After the gymnast, the Rector of UNS delivered his speech before dispatching the participants of Green Walk.

“Participants from the Faculty of Cultural Study (FIB), Faculty of Sports (FKOR), Faculty of Teacher Training and Education (FKIP), and Faculty of Law, let me hear your voice!” shouted Prof. Jamal greeting the participants of Green Walk from each faculty.

In front of the participants, Prof. Jamal also invited the academic member of UNS to attend the Senate Meeting of UNS 44th Anniversary. In the Senate Meeting that will be held on Wednesday (11/3/2020), The Minister of Research and Technology (Menristek) who is also the Head of the National Innovation Research Agency (BRIN), Bambang Brodjonegoro, will deliver his scientific speech.

“On the UNS 44th Anniversary Commemoration, UNS will also grant Parasamya Anugraha Dharma Krida Baraya award to the Vice President of the Republic of Indonesia, Prof. Dr. K.H. Ma’ruf Amin, for his Distinction in Sharia Economy,” Prof. Jamal added.

After delivering the opening speech, Prof. Jamal sent out the participant of Green Walk. The Green Walk route was the UNS area, starting from the Faculty of Law, Faculty of Social and Political Science (FISIP), and stopped in the finish line set in UNS Lake.

A participant of Green Walk who is a student of FKOR UNS, Florentina Vanda, appreciated the event. For her, sports activities should be held in UNS so that its academic members will adopt a healthy lifestyle in the campus.
